Transaction 34d6482cc4efe37b95b569766523b08e7fa200f5d3c09ee94d2e69df8cd82861
1 Input
2 Outputs
- 34d6482cc4efe37b95b569766523b08e7fa200f5d3c09ee94d2e69df8cd82861:0
- 34d6482cc4efe37b95b569766523b08e7fa200f5d3c09ee94d2e69df8cd82861:1
value 94501627
address 14ygEk4y5S3KHhbY9gvVtZqDGACSN3PfKS
value 1662996
address 1AgVTZBgqXuxC8RtnC6W4rK5TiENXSGx43